The shape on the left is translated to the shape on the right. Shape M N O P Q R S is translated 6 units to the right. Which sta

tement about the transformation is true? The name of the shape on the right is M N O P Q R S prime because it is the image of the shape on the left. The name of the shape on the right is M N O P Q R S prime because it is the pre-image of the shape on the left. The name of the shape on the right is M prime N prime O prime P prime Q prime R prime S prime because it is the pre-image of the shape on the left. The name of the shape on the right is M prime N prime O prime P prime Q prime R prime S prime because it is the image of the shape on the left.

Answer:

The name of the shape on the right is M prime N prime O prime P prime Q prime R prime S prime because it is the image of the shape on the left

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The rule of the translation of the pre-image to the image is equal to

(x,y) ----> (x+6,y)

The pre-image is the shape on the left

The image is the shape on the right

The pre-image is MNOPQRS

The image is M'N'O'P'Q'R'S'

therefore

The name of the shape on the right is M prime N prime O prime P prime Q prime R prime S prime because it is the image of the shape on the left
